
No. 7 UCLA Defeats Washington State, 1-0
October 21, 2000 | Women's Soccer
Oct. 21, 2000
PULLMAN, Wash. - With a goal just over one minute into the game, number seven UCLA scored the game-winner to beat the Cougars 1-0 today in Pullman, Wash. The Bruins are tied for second in the conference at 12-1-1 overall and 3-0-1 in the Pac-10 while the Cougars entered the weekend in fifth place with a 10-5-0 overall record, 2-3-0 in the Pac-10.
Tracey Milburn scored the Bruins goal 1:05 into the game on a 10-yard shot from the left side of the box that she finished far side. Milburn entered the week tied for third in the conference in scoring, and the goal was her 12th this season.
UCLA travels next to Seattle for a Sunday showdown with No. 3 Washington. That match begins at Noon.
